The use of OU (Organizational Units) by your exchange server is normal for the situation you find yourself in. I am presuming that your PDA does not have access to your exchange server at the time you create the e-mail message, which would cause exactly the problem you are experiencing.
If you are intent on using your company's intranet to send the mail, then compose and save your messages, and simply click send ONLY ONCE you are back at work in front of your desktop that your PocketPC synchronizes with.
However, if you want to send the mail while you are at a hotspot (or some location not on your company intranet), then you'll need to find the Internet e-mail address for these individuals, which may be buried as a different field name in your Database.
